International Student Riding Competitions
This special kind of competition is open to University Student Riders from around the world. Each rider will compete in both Dressage and Show Jumping. The hosting country is responsible for the riders from the beginning of the competition until the end. This includes housing, feeding and transportation as well as providing horses for the competition.
There are normally between 12 and 18 teams from different countries with three riders per team.
Competitions are designed in a tournament style with each round increasing the level of difficulty. The organizers of the competition supply the horses which are drawn at random by the competitors to determine who will ride which horse. A five minute warm-up and two practice jumps in the show jumping are permitted prior to each ride. Each horse in every round has three riders, the best of whom advances to the next round. Therefore, the "luck-of-the-draw" is diminished since each rider is only competing directly against the other two riders on his or her horse.
DRESSAGE
In the first round the entire team rides a test together. The team receive a team score and each rider is also judged individually (four judges are used to judge the first round). For the remaining rounds, riders do their tests individually. The two finalists ride two final rounds consisting of a musical freestyle and a Prix St. George level test.

SHOW JUMPING
The first round is judged on style, the second round on faults then style. From the third round on, faults then time decide. The two finalists ride two horses each over a course that may be a maximum height of 4'6".

Categories of competitions:
C.H.I.U. (International University Equestrian Competition)
S.R.N.C. (Student Riding Nations Cup)
W.U.E.C. (World University Equestrian Championship)
All competitions are held under the auspices of the
International University Equestrian Federation (A.I.E.C.)
